The first question should be "What is Emacs?" The first answer on debugging should be "-Q" in order to find out if the problem is with Emacs or in the user's setup. People who have problems with Emacs and come here and ask about it sometimes get a bit embarrassed when trying -Q to find out the problem is with them and not with Emacs. This Q&A in a FAQ could spare some of them this experience. But actually I don't think it is anything to be embarrassed about. Furthermore they might still need help with their situation.
